Flynote
Practice and procedure – parties – joinder – principles – joinder of third party – avoidance of multiplicity of actions dealing with same subject-matter and involving same evidence
Practice and procedure – prescription – under State Liabilities Act [Chapter 8:14] – sixty day period – applicability – only applicable to claims for money or for delivery of goods – not applicable to claim for joinder – court's discretion to condone non-compliance with sixty day period – when discretion may be exercised
